St. John’s RNC have issued an arrest warrant for a 36-year-old man in connection with the abduction of his daughter. Cst Stephanie Myers says this warrant is far reaching as the two are now believed to be in Egypt. She says police got a report during the evening of September 27th that the 5-year-old girl had been taken from the country by a person known to her. Ahmed Mohamed Shafik Abelfat Elgammal is wanted on charges of abduction in contravention of a custody or parenting order. This is an active and ongoing investigation and the RNC is using all available resources to locate and confirm the safety of the child.
